If the marginal propensity to consume is 0.80, what is the total implied increase in economic spending activity from a governmen

t stimulus of $100 billion? Type an answer and press enter to submit billion dollars
Business
2 answers:
Rzqust [24]4 years ago
7 0

\$500 is the total implied increase in economic spending activity from a government stimulus of \$100 billion

<u>Explanation: </u>

The median product preference tests the increase in expenditure due to changes in availability.

In increasing government expenditure, total economic investment would be increased by the scale of the budget multiplier. In other terms, the expenditure equation indicates how much GDP can increase as government expenditure increases.

The spending multiplier can be expressed as \frac{1}{1-M P C} \text { or } \frac{1}{M P S}

\text { Increase in GDP }=\frac{1}{1-M P C} \times \Delta G=\frac{1}{1-0.8} \times 100=\$ 500

So, the total implied increase in economic spending is \$ 500

In economics, marginal propensity to consume (MPC) is the proportion of an aggregate raise in pay that consumer spends on the consumption of services and goods, as opposed to saving it.

Which of the following helps to maintain the current level of nitrogen in Earth's atmosphere?
zepelin [54]
The answer for this question is a. lightning.

Lightning is an important phenomenon that plays a significant role in nitrogen fixation step in the nitrogen cycle. Lightning helps to "fix" the inert nitrogen present in the atmosphere by breaking nitrogen molecules and combining them with oxygen to form nitrogen oxides. The resulting compounds are then readily absorbed by rain then the soil.
